Dorett Richard, a health system specialist and data analyst in the Quality Management Department, helped the command refine its effort to implement projects with the greatest impact by identifying areas for quality improvement. The two Lean Six Sigma projects she led improved communication between clinical areas and streamlined processes for procurement of simulation mannequins. As a co-coordinator for the inaugural Quality Symposium, she helped NMCP showcase its quality improvement efforts to participants and attendees throughout the region. In addition to registering participants and assisting with setting up poster displays at the Quality Symposium, she presented her own poster, detailing the Simulation Center’s process improvement project. This process improvement project helped NMCP medical care staff and physicians advance their simulation skills to improve patient care. Going above and beyond, Richard spearheaded the NMCP Wednesday’s Word Ministry that is televised throughout the command for patients and staff.
